International Biometric Group Releases Biometric Market Report 2003-2007; Industry Revenues Projected to Exceed $4 Billion in 2007

    ARLINGTON, Va., Sept. 23, 2002 -- International Biometric Group
(IBG) announces the release of its Biometric Market Report 2003-2007, the
industry's most comprehensive and authoritative analysis of biometric
technologies, applications, and markets.  The Report provides critical
post-9/11 market data and real-world guidance to biometric technology
deployers, developers, investors, and researchers.
    Highlights include annual revenue projections from 2002 through 2007 for
the 9 leading biometric technologies, the 7 leading biometric applications,
and the 5 leading biometric verticals.  Each market segment features in-depth
analysis of growth drivers and inhibitors, leading vendors and technologies,
and critical deployments.  In addition, the Report includes exclusive research
on the biometric industry's "Top 20" vendors.

    Among the Report's high-level findings are the following:
     -- Global 2002 industry revenues of $600m are expected to reach $4.04b by
        2007, driven by large-scale public sector biometric deployments, the
        emergence of transactional revenue models, and the adoption of
        standardized biometric infrastructures and data formats.

     -- Fingerprint-based technologies accounted for $467m of 2002 industry
        revenues, far and away the largest technology segment.  This growth is
        attributable to the wide range of applications in which fingerprint-
        based solutions operate effectively.  Among emerging biometric
        technologies, Facial-Scan and Middleware are projected to reach $200m
        and $215m, respectively, in annual revenues in 2005.  Iris-Scan is
        projected to reach $210m in annual revenue in 2007.

     -- Civil ID and PC / Network Access will be the leading biometric
        applications over the next five years, expected to account for nearly
        $2b in combined annual revenues in 2007.  Physical Access / Time and
        Attendance will reach $245m in annual revenues by 2004, with
        Surveillance and Screening applications projected to reach $49m in
        annual revenue in 2004.

     -- Government Sector will be the leading biometric vertical market
        through 2007 with $1.2b in annual revenues.  Financial Sector and
        Travel and Transportation follow with $672m and $556m, respectively,
        in 2007.  The various scenarios in which government agencies must
        identify and authenticate both citizens and employees, particularly
        subsequent to 9/11, is a critical growth factor.
